Apple Dumplings:
1 pkg ready to bake crescent rolls ( I used the low fat ones, 90 cals each)
4 tsp sugar (I used Splenda)
3 tsp cinnamon (divided)
2 small tart apples, peeled and sliced
1/2c of water
2 tsp of marg
1- preheat oven to 350
2- separate crescent rolls, flatten and stretch each piece
3-mix sugar and 2 tsp of cinnamon and roll apples in mixture, divide evenly among the rolls, fold the dough over the apples and pinch to close openings
4-place in a baking dish (with sides)
5- mix water, 1 tsp of cinnamon and leftover cin/suar mixture, pour over dumplings
6-dot each dumpling with margarine (I didn't do this, but they were still good...I just sprinkled a bit of splenda over the top of them)
7- bake, uncovered 25-30 minutes or until rolls are browned
as made (per Corinne's recipe) yield: 8 dumplings, 130 cals, 6 g of fat each
